Hakuba | Japan

Hakuba is one of Japan’s most iconic snow destinations, set deep in the Japanese Alps and famed for its reliable powder, long vertical and incredible variety. Spread across a collection of resorts running the length of the valley, Hakuba offers something new every day; from wide, confidence‑boosting groomers to tree runs and alpine terrain when the snow stacks up. It’s a place that suits both first‑time Japan skiers and seasoned snow travellers chasing depth, scale and choice.

But Hakuba is about more than just what’s under your skis. After the lifts close, the valley comes alive with cosy bars, standout local dining and traditional onsen hot springs — the perfect way to unwind after a full day on the mountain. With a laid‑back alpine town feel and a strong snow culture, Hakuba balances adventure with ease.
